Robert Pichette ONB AIH FRHSC (born 7 August 1936) is the son of Albert Pichette, Judge of the Court of Queen's Bench of New Brunswick. The designer of the flag of New Brunswick, Pichette has been involved in heraldry and vexillology for much of his life, and currently holds the title of Dauphin Herald Extraordinary with the Canadian Heraldic Authority.

Flag of New Brunswick

The current flag of New Brunswick, which is a banner of the provincial coat of arms, was adopted by proclamation on 24 February 1965. Robert Pichette, at the time the Administrative Assistant in the Premier's office, was instrumental in having the design and prototypes created in under two weeks. Political pressure to proclaim the Red Ensign as the new provincial flag prompted the quick design. Pichette was assisted by Alan Beddoe, who drew the actual design.

Honours and awards

  • Dauphin Herald Extraordinary, Canadian Heraldic Authority
  • Honorary consul of the Republic of Guinea-Bissau
  • Officer of the National Order of Merit of France
  • Vice-President of the Canadian Association of the National Order of Merit
  • Knight of the Order of Arts and Letters
  • Knight of the Order of Academic Palms of France
  • Coronation medal
  • Centennial Medal of Canada
  • Queen's Jubilee Medal
  • Canada 125 medal
  • Commander of the Most Venerable Order of Saint John of Jerusalem
  • Knight Grand Cross in Obedience of the Sovereign Order of Malta
  • Doctor of Letters, honoris causa, Universite Sainte-Anne in Nova Scotia
  • Order of New Brunswick
